A video purportedly from Hanuman Garhi in Ayodhya has gone viral on social media, showing an alleged altercation between police personnel and a devotee inside the temple premises.

According to claims circulating online, a police officer allegedly used abusive language and pushed a devotee during a dispute. The devotee reportedly objected to what he described as preferential treatment being given to individuals paying for VIP darshan, accusing temple authorities of allowing them to move ahead in the queue.

The situation is said to have escalated into a heated exchange, with visuals suggesting physical confrontation between the devotee and police personnel. Unverified reports claim that after being pushed and verbally abused, the young man reacted aggressively, further intensifying the chaos at the site.

The authenticity of the video and the exact sequence of events have not yet been officially confirmed. Authorities are expected to review the footage and determine whether any misconduct occurred. The incident has triggered strong reactions online, with many users demanding a fair investigation and appropriate action if wrongdoing is established. Observers note that maintaining discipline and respectful conduct within temple premises is essential, especially in a high-footfall religious site like Hanuman Garhi.

Officials have yet to issue a detailed statement regarding the matter. An official inquiry, if initiated, will clarify responsibilities and help restore public confidence in law enforcement at religious places.
